Staff Engineer

Work Flexibility: Hybrid Join a role focused on bringing innovative products from concept to commercialization through engineering expertise, design validation, and process development. As a Staff Engineer, you will contribute to product and manufacturing solutions by combining technical knowledge, analytical decision-making, and cross-functional collaboration in a regulated environment.

What You Will Do Design and develop new products, components, and systems based on defined functional requirements. Create and maintain engineering drawings, models, specifications, and bills of materials using CAD/CAE tools. Plan, execute, and evaluate design verification, validation, and fitness-for-use testing activities.

Develop and implement process formulations, methods, controls, and validation plans to meet quality requirements. Analyze design performance, reliability, safety, manufacturability, and cost considerations throughout development. Collaborate with manufacturing teams, suppliers, contract manufacturers, and technical specialists to optimize product and process designs.

Review product development requirements and assess compatibility with manufacturing methods, schedules, and cost targets. Recommend, document, and implement engineering improvements, process modifications, and technical solutions based on data analysis.

What You Will Need Required: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or a related technical field and fluent English Minimum 4 years of engineering experience in product development, design engineering, process engineering, or a related discipline.

Experience with product design, testing, validation, and technical documentation. Experience using CAD or CAE software for modeling, design, or engineering analysis

Preferred

  • Experience in a regulated industry such as medical devices, pharmaceuticals, aerospace, automotive, or healthcare manufacturing are highly desirable.
  • Experience developing and executing process validation plans.
  • Experience working with manufacturing partners, suppliers, or contract manufacturers.
  • Knowledge of quality systems, design controls, and engineering change management processes.
